In this commentary, former Italian Undersecretary of Defence and former Chairman of Parliament’s Security Committee Raffaele Volpi argues that artificial intelligence has become a new gateway for strategic influence, making technological choices inseparable from national security. While China poses a growing challenge through AI ecosystems, he contends that Europe’s answer lies not in equidistance between Beijing and Washington, but in building the autonomous capabilities needed to preserve strategic sovereignty.
The participation of the Director General of AgID in the World Artificial Intelligence Conference in Shanghai highlights a significant disconnect in Italy: while the government maintains a clear Euro-Atlantic orientation, public administrations, companies, and research centers often treat technological decisions as separate from national security. Unlike the transparent 2019 Memorandum, Chinese influence now infiltrates through less visible channels such as industrial partnerships, university agreements, cloud services, and inexpensive, easily integrated AI models. Each of these seemingly minor steps gradually builds dependency without requiring high-level political intervention. This fragmentation poses the greatest risk, as Beijing can achieve strategic realignment by accumulating many small decisions—e.g., adopting cheaper software or selecting infrastructure without considering future dependency. By the time the cumulative effect is recognized, the cost of reversing these dependencies becomes substantial.
Artificial intelligence is more than just an enabling technology; it's rapidly becoming the primary conduit through which society acquires information, interprets reality, and forms judgments. Unlike social media, where content is clearly attributed to an identifiable actor, users tend to perceive AI systems as neutral sources, attributing a higher authority to their responses. This perception makes AI an unprecedented intermediary of information, deceptively appearing non-intermediated. However, absolute neutrality in an AI model is a myth, as every system is shaped by its training data, selected sources, instructions, and filters. Without explicit propaganda, subtle manipulations—such as downplaying certain information or marginalizing specific sources—can be employed by those who control these models. This gives controllers an unparalleled tool to shape public opinion and poses a significant "cognitive backdoor" risk.
It's crucial to acknowledge that the challenges posed by AI models are not exclusive to Chinese systems; American models, on which Europe heavily relies, also inherently lack absolute neutrality. The fundamental difference between them lies not in their inherent purity, but in the legal and oversight frameworks within which these technologies operate. An AI model developed in a democracy is subject to legal recourse, parliamentary scrutiny, a free press, and corporate accountability, providing mechanisms for verification and contestation. Conversely, an AI ecosystem embedded within an authoritarian system offers none of these safeguards, as such systems are designed to resist external verification. Therefore, the real distinction for strategic security is an AI system's contestability—its openness to challenge and oversight—rather than an unattainable ideal of pure neutrality.
While the threat from authoritarian AI systems like China's is clear, Europe also faces a distinct, albeit different, challenge in its relationship with the United States. Relying on an ally for critical computing power, cloud infrastructure, and AI models still constitutes a form of dependency. This exposure means that Europe could be subject to regulatory or extraterritorial decisions made by the US for its own national interests, which may not always align with Europe's, as evidenced by past disputes over tariffs and semiconductors. An alliance, by itself, does not guarantee a complete coincidence of interests. Therefore, Europe's strategic response should not be to maintain equidistance between Washington and Beijing—which would be a strategic miscalculation—but rather to develop autonomous European capabilities. This autonomy would transform transatlantic cooperation from a necessity into a deliberate choice, strengthening Europe's position.
To navigate the complexities of AI influence and dependency, a dual approach is essential, focusing on both robust procedures and enhanced capabilities. First, clearer procedural rules are needed for international activities of public administrations in strategic sectors, ensuring better coordination with national security authorities on technological decisions. Companies require advanced technological risk assessment tools that extend beyond mere formal compliance. Universities and research centers need proportionate regulations to differentiate legitimate academic cooperation from the illicit transfer of sensitive knowledge. Second, Europe must significantly invest in its capabilities. Relying solely on prohibitions is insufficient; companies cannot be expected to forgo competitive technology without viable alternatives. Therefore, Europe must strategically invest in computing capacity, cloud infrastructure, semiconductors, large language models, cybersecurity, and dual-use applications. This involves unifying fragmented industrial ecosystems across research, industry, defence, and space to achieve not unrealistic self-sufficiency, but the autonomous capacity to make informed choices.
Maintaining relations with China remains a pragmatic necessity, and complete economic or technological decoupling is an unrealistic goal. However, this cooperation must be balanced with the ability to critically distinguish between standard economic exchange and activities that foster strategic dependency or exert informational influence. The core challenge for Italy and Europe is not merely how effectively China can exploit existing vulnerabilities, but rather the internal capacity to recognize these vulnerabilities before they mature into irreversible dependencies. In the rapidly evolving landscape of artificial intelligence, the concept of national sovereignty has expanded beyond traditional domains like ports, networks, and critical infrastructure. It now fundamentally encompasses the freedom and integrity with which a society forms its own convictions and processes information, underscoring the profound geopolitical stakes of AI development and adoption.
